Capabilities

Our Capabilities

Laser cutting is used for accurate flat profiles, covers, brackets, panels, gaskets, and formed sheet metal blanks. Suitable for prototypes and production runs where edge quality and feature accuracy matter.

We use stamping and forming to produce sheet metal parts with controlled bends, flanges, tabs, ribs, and structural features. Supports progressive die operations and single-hit forming depending on quantity and complexity.

Photochemical etching can make thin metal parts with complex patterns, fine features, and tight tolerances that mechanical cutting cannot achieve. Ideal for shims, screens, EMI shields, and decorative panels.

Water jet cutting is good for thick plates, heat-sensitive materials, and parts that require no heat-affected zone. Supports aluminum, steel, brass, copper, and composite sheet materials.

Join sheet metal components with TIG, MIG, spot welding, or riveting depending on material, strength requirements, and cosmetic needs. Fabricated assemblies with controlled tolerance stack-up, no multi-vendor hand-off.
